The steel anvil (100 mm diameter \u00d7 70 mm height) is screwed onto the top of a steel block (230 mm length \u00d7 250 mm width \u00d7 200 mm height) with a base (450 mm length \u00d7 450 mm width \u00d7 60 mm height). A column of seamless drawn steel tubing is fixed in a bracket that is bolted to the back of the steel block. The fallhammer is fixed with 4 anchoring screws on a solid concrete block (60 cm \u00d7 60 cm) in such a way that the guides are exactly vertical and the drop weight is easily guided. Drop weights are made of solid steel and are available, for example, in 5 kg and 10 kg weights. The striking head of each weight is made of hardened steel, HRC 60 to 63, and has a minimum diameter of 25 mm.<\/p>\n<p>The test result is assessed as positive if an explosion (a bang and\/or ignition is equivalent to an explosion) occurs with the apparatus described in at least one test.[\/vc_column_text][vc_row_inner rt_row_style=&#8221;global-style&#8221;
